Etymology

[edit]

From Old Dutch gibrūkan, from Proto-Germanic *gabrūkaną. Equivalent to ge- +‎ bruken.

Verb

[edit]

gebruken

  1. to enjoy
  2. to have free use of, to have at one's disposal, to reap all the rewards of
  3. to use

Descendants

[edit]
  • Dutch: gebruiken
  • Limburgish: gebroeke
